Police investigating a rape in Ancoats are appealing for witnesses.
Shortly before 3.40am on Sunday 10 December, police were called to reports of a rape on George Leigh Street in Manchester.
A 20-year-old woman was walking back from ‘Guilty’ nightclub on Stevenson Square when she was raped.
The woman then told a person who was nearby what had happened, at which point police were called.
The offender is described as a white man in his mid-20s.
